RepVue
Back

Leadr

63 Employee Ratings
63 Ratings
86% Verified
3.3
Engaged Employer
Rate this Company
RepVue Score0
RepVue Score

0

Leadr
63 Employee Ratings
86% Verified
3.3
Engaged Employer
77.61
RepVue Score
Back to Reviews
User Company Avatar
Current Employee
4.4
Jun 3, 2025
Life changing. The level of care and development is unmatched by any other company I've worked for. The people here truly care about you, as well as being super business-minded. It's a wonderful place to learn, be driven and motivated to do your best, and to feel the benefits of being invested in.
Useful
Share
Browse Other Reviews
Reviews at Leadr